NAME

PDL::GSLSF::BESSEL - PDL interface to GSL Special Functions  

DESCRIPTION

This is an interface to the Special Function package present in the GNU Scientific Library.  

SYNOPSIS

 

Functions

 

FUNCTIONS

 

gsl_sf_bessel_Jn

  Signature: (double x(); double [o]y(); double [o]e(); int n)

Regular Bessel Function J_n(x).  

gsl_sf_bessel_J_array

  Signature: (double x(); double [o]y(num); int s; int n=>num)

Array of Regular Bessel Functions J_{s}(x) to J_{s+n-1}(x).  

gsl_sf_bessel_Yn

  Signature: (double x(); double [o]y(); double [o]e(); int n)

IrRegular Bessel Function Y_n(x).  

gsl_sf_bessel_Y_array

  Signature: (double x(); double [o]y(num); int s; int n=>num)

Array of Regular Bessel Functions Y_{s}(x) to Y_{s+n-1}(x).  

gsl_sf_bessel_In

  Signature: (double x(); double [o]y(); double [o]e(); int n)

Regular Modified Bessel Function I_n(x).  

gsl_sf_bessel_I_array

  Signature: (double x(); double [o]y(num); int s; int n=>num)

Array of Regular Modified Bessel Functions I_{s}(x) to I_{s+n-1}(x).  

gsl_sf_bessel_In_scaled

  Signature: (double x(); double [o]y(); double [o]e(); int n)

Scaled Regular Modified Bessel Function exp(-|x|) I_n(x).  

gsl_sf_bessel_I_scaled_array

  Signature: (double x(); double [o]y(num); int s; int n=>num)

Array of Scaled Regular Modified Bessel Functions exp(-|x|) I_{s}(x) to exp(-|x|) I_{s+n-1}(x).  

gsl_sf_bessel_Kn

  Signature: (double x(); double [o]y(); double [o]e(); int n)

IrRegular Modified Bessel Function K_n(x).  

gsl_sf_bessel_K_array

  Signature: (double x(); double [o]y(num); int s; int n=>num)

Array of IrRegular Modified Bessel Functions K_{s}(x) to K_{s+n-1}(x).  

gsl_sf_bessel_Kn_scaled

  Signature: (double x(); double [o]y(); double [o]e(); int n)

Scaled IrRegular Modified Bessel Function exp(-|x|) K_n(x).  

gsl_sf_bessel_K_scaled_array

  Signature: (double x(); double [o]y(num); int s; int n=>num)

Array of Scaled IrRegular Modified Bessel Functions exp(-|x|) K_{s}(x) to exp(-|x|) K_{s+n-1}(x).  

gsl_sf_bessel_jl

  Signature: (double x(); double [o]y(); double [o]e(); int n)

Regular Sphericl Bessel Function J_n(x).  

gsl_sf_bessel_j_array

  Signature: (double x(); double [o]y(num); int n=>num)

Array of Spherical Regular Bessel Functions J_{0}(x) to J_{n-1}(x).  

gsl_sf_bessel_yl

  Signature: (double x(); double [o]y(); double [o]e(); int n)

IrRegular Spherical Bessel Function y_n(x).  

gsl_sf_bessel_y_array

  Signature: (double x(); double [o]y(num); int n=>num)

Array of Regular Spherical Bessel Functions y_{0}(x) to y_{n-1}(x).  

gsl_sf_bessel_il_scaled

  Signature: (double x(); double [o]y(); double [o]e(); int n)

Scaled Regular Modified Spherical Bessel Function exp(-|x|) i_n(x).  

gsl_sf_bessel_i_scaled_array

  Signature: (double x(); double [o]y(num); int n=>num)

Array of Scaled Regular Modified Spherical Bessel Functions exp(-|x|) i_{0}(x) to exp(-|x|) i_{n-1}(x).  

gsl_sf_bessel_kl_scaled

  Signature: (double x(); double [o]y(); double [o]e(); int n)

Scaled IrRegular Modified Spherical Bessel Function exp(-|x|) k_n(x).  

gsl_sf_bessel_k_scaled_array

  Signature: (double x(); double [o]y(num); int n=>num)

Array of Scaled IrRegular Modified Spherical Bessel Functions exp(-|x|) k_{s}(x) to exp(-|x|) k_{s+n-1}(x).  

gsl_sf_bessel_Jnu

  Signature: (double x(); double [o]y(); double [o]e(); double n)

Regular Cylindrical Bessel Function J_nu(x).  

gsl_sf_bessel_Ynu

  Signature: (double x(); double [o]y(); double [o]e(); double n)

IrRegular Cylindrical Bessel Function J_nu(x).  

gsl_sf_bessel_Inu_scaled

  Signature: (double x(); double [o]y(); double [o]e(); double n)

Scaled Modified Cylindrical Bessel Function exp(-|x|) I_nu(x).  

gsl_sf_bessel_Inu

  Signature: (double x(); double [o]y(); double [o]e(); double n)

Modified Cylindrical Bessel Function I_nu(x).  

gsl_sf_bessel_Knu_scaled

  Signature: (double x(); double [o]y(); double [o]e(); double n)

Scaled Modified Cylindrical Bessel Function exp(-|x|) K_nu(x).  

gsl_sf_bessel_Knu

  Signature: (double x(); double [o]y(); double [o]e(); double n)

Modified Cylindrical Bessel Function K_nu(x).  

gsl_sf_bessel_lnKnu

  Signature: (double x(); double [o]y(); double [o]e(); double n)

Logarithm of Modified Cylindrical Bessel Function K_nu(x).
